The Korena take

For alto saxophone, the Forestone Hinoki MH is a composite reed made from polypropylene resin and cellulose wood fiber, with bamboo representing more than half of the fiber used. Its smooth, injection-molded vamp is balanced in both directions and tapers to a 0.1 mm tip. It is intended to deliver a clear, robust core with enough buzz for projection, alongside stable intonation and articulate response. Its composite construction also resists water-logging, saliva breakdown, and warping caused by humidity or altitude changes.

01What is the primary material?

The reed combines polypropylene resin with cellulose wood fiber, and more than half of the wood fiber is bamboo.

02How can I alter blowing resistance?

Position it slightly lower on the mouthpiece table for slightly less resistance, or slightly higher for slightly more.

03Does it resist moisture damage?

Yes. The composite material is described as impervious to water-logging and breakdown by saliva.
